Domingo sarmiento, however, expressed affection towards the united states and its institutions. As a proponent of liberalism, sarmiento deeply argued for the value of education, logic, and political autonomy. Sarmiento described the united states as the end result of human logic (331). In his belief, the united states represents the gold standard for all three virtues. He paints american society composed of rational, educated individuals.
